From the files of stranger than fiction, the founder and former CEO of ForSalebyOwner.com, Colby Sambrotto, was unable to sell his OWN HOME so he turned to a REALTOR® to get the job done.

According to The Wall Street Journal, Mr. Sambrotto gave  up the FSBO route in favor of hiring a broker. This good decision resulted in attracting multiple offers for his 2000 square foot condominium in New York and a final sales price $150,000 more than the original asking price.  The WSJ said that the listing sold for $2,150,000 which included a 6 percent broker fee.

His own marketing efforts, which included his own online classified ads and FSBO sites, failed to get the job done.
